Supplement Facts

Serving Size: 1 Tablet(s) · 1 per day

IngredientAmount Per Serving% Daily Value
Vitamin A(Beta-Carotene, Vitamin A Acetate)1050 mcg117%
Vitamin C(Ascorbic Acid)60 mg67%
Vitamin D3(Cholecalciferol)10 mcg50%
Vitamin E(DL-Alpha-Tocopheryl Acetate)13.5 mg90%
Vitamin K(Phytonadione)25 mcg21%
Thiamine(Thiamine Mononitrate, Vitamin B1)1.5 mg125%
Riboflavin(Vitamin B2)1.7 mg131%
Niacin(Niacinamide)20 mg125%
Vitamin B6(Pyridoxine Hydrochloride)2 mg118%
Folate667 mcg DFE167%
Folic Acid400 mcg
Vitamin B12(Cyanocobalamin)6 mcg250%
Biotin30 mcg100%
Pantothenic Acid(D-Calcium Pantothenate)10 mg200%
Calcium(Calcium Carbonate, Dicalcium Phosphate)200 mg15%
Iron(Ferrous Fumarate)18 mg100%
Phosphorus(Dicalcium Phosphate)20 mg2%
Iodine(Potassium Iodide)150 mcg100%
Magnesium(Magnesium Oxide)50 mg12%
Zinc(Zinc Oxide)11 mg100%
Selenium(Sodium Selenate)55 mcg100%
Copper(Copper Sulfate)0.5 mg56%
Manganese(Manganese Sulfate)2.3 mg100%
Chromium(Chromium Picolinate)35 mcg100%
Molybdenum(Sodium Molybdate)45 mcg100%
Chloride(Potassium Chloride)72 mg3%
Potassium(Potassium Chloride)80 mg2%
Boron(Sodium Borate)75 mcg
Tin(Rice Chelate)10 mcg
Nickel(Nickel Sulfate)5 mcg
Vanadium(Sodium Metavanadate)10 mcg

Important Information: Extended use of high levels of Vitamin A (excluding Beta-Carotene as the source) may increase the risk to adults of developing osteoporosis. Do not use this product if using other Vitamin A supplements.

Precautions re: Children

Warning: Accidental overdose of iron-containing products is a leading cause of fatal poisoning in children under 6. Keep this product out of reach of children. In case of accidental overdose, call a doctor or Poison Control Center immediately.
